Production Director Clarius Mobile Health The Director, Production is responsible for leading the planning, execution, and continuous improvement of all production operations. This role ensures that products are manufactured safely, efficiently, and to the highest quality standards, while meeting delivery schedules and cost targets. The Director provides strategic leadership to the production team, drives operational excellence, and partners with cross‑functional teams to support business growth and scalability.
This is an established leadership role at Clarius Mobile Health and includes a planned transition period. You will lead a well‑established, high‑performing team of nearly 30 people across Manufacturing Technicians, Shipping and Receiving, Inventory Control, and Manufacturing Engineering.
